About Ashfield 2131

The size of Ashfield is approximately 3.4 square kilometres. It has 24 parks covering nearly 7.2% of total area. The population of Ashfield in 2016 was 23841 people. By 2021 the population was 23012 showing a population decline of 3.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Ashfield is 20-29 years. Households in Ashfield are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Ashfield work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 45.10% of the homes in Ashfield were owner-occupied compared with 43.80% in 2016.

Ashfield has 13,098 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Ashfield have seen a 46.44%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 35.46% increase. As at 28 February 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Ashfield is $2,442,195 while the median value for Units is $939,939.
  • Houses have a median rent of $700 while Units have a median rent of $660.
